Professional Dancer Salary in the United States

How much does a Professional Dancer make in the United States?

As of April 01, 2026, the average salary for a Professional Dancer in the United States is $76,332 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$37.

However, a Professional Dancer's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$89,042
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$68,156 to $82,985
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$60,712

How Experience Level Affects Professional Dancer Salaries?

Experience is a primary driver of a Professional Dancer's salary. As you build your skills and take on more complex tasks, your compensation generally increases. Here's how the average salary grows at different career stages:

  • Entry-Level (less than 1 year): $75,196
  • Early Career (1-2 years): $75,537
  • Mid-Level (2-4 years): $76,673
  • Senior-Level (5-8 years): $78,035
  • Expert (over 8 years): $79,753

Top Paying Cities for Professional Dancers

Salaries can also vary between different cities. Major metropolitan areas or cities with a high demand for technicians often offer more competitive pay. Here are a few examples of average annual salaries in different U.S. cities:

  • San Jose: $96,278
  • San Francisco: $95,331
  • Oakland: $93,217
